About ZIP code 00683
The housing stock consists of predominantly single-family detached homes. Most homes were built in the 1970s, giving the area an established character. Median home value is $97,200. Owner-occupancy sits near the national average at 68%.
Median household income is $18,132. Poverty affects 49% of residents, above the national average. SNAP benefit usage at 53% of households reflects economic stress in the area. 55% of households receive Social Security income, suggesting a notable retiree or disability population.
The dominant occupation class is management, business, and professional, with education and healthcare as the leading industry. The average commute of 27 minutes is near the national average.
Overall, ZIP code 00683 reflects a community defined by economic challenges above the national average, a significant Social Security-dependent population, and elevated reliance on food assistance.
